鏡面鋁板效果是如何形成的?

鏡面鋁板的鏡面效果來源于兩個方面,一是基材本身要達到鏡面,二是氧化膜要高度清純透明.的氧化鋁板鏡面效果有目共睹,現(xiàn)在技術(shù)員與大家分析鏡面效果的形成。

鋁合金表面做草酸氧化膜和鉻酸氧化膜帶有顏色,不是清澈透明的,自然不在考慮之列.對硫酸氧化膜而言,影響透明度的因素主要有:氧化膜純度/氧化膜厚度/氧化膜孔隙率/封孔質(zhì)量.氧化膜中如果裹挾有過多的硅/錳/鐵/銅/鉻等雜質(zhì)離子(或原子),氧化膜的純度就低,透明度就會下降.氧化膜雖然是透光的,但也會有一些光散射損失.氧化膜厚度增加時透明度也會下降.氧化膜的針孔是光散射的主要根源,孔隙率越高光散射就越多.

特別是針孔呈顯著的喇叭形時,光散射會急劇增加,透明度就會迅速下降.封孔物質(zhì)是勃姆石,常溫封孔時還有氫氧化鎳和氟鋁酸鹽,它們都是透明的,因此正常的封孔基本上不會降低氧化膜的透明度.但是如果發(fā)生過封孔,所形成的粉霜就全部成為光散射質(zhì)點,就會使氧化膜的透明度大幅降低.所以,改善氧化膜的透明度應(yīng)從提高氧化膜純度/控制氧化膜厚度/降低氧化膜孔隙率/保證封孔適度這四個方面入手。

氧化膜中的雜質(zhì)主要來源于鋁件本身,次要來源是氧化槽液.因此,適當降低鋁件中合金元素的含量,盡量降低鋁件的雜質(zhì)含量,甚至選用高純鋁都能提高氧化膜純度.降低槽液中的雜離子,保持槽液新鮮也能提高氧化膜純度.氧化膜厚度以控制在10-12um為宜,如果產(chǎn)品標準不要求氧化膜厚度>=10um,則將氧化膜厚度控制在6-8um.氧化膜的孔隙率主要取決于溶膜速度,溶膜越快則孔隙率越大.溶膜速度與硫酸濃度/槽液溫度/電流密度成正變關(guān)系,因此,適當降低硫酸濃度/槽液穩(wěn)度/電流密度過都會降低氧化膜的孔率。
